bolle732 commented 5 years ago

How old is old ? Is this a Geoworks Ensemble 1.x document ? Then you have to convert it first with:

http://geos-infobase.de/download/1XUPDATE.ZIP

Yes, to generate a PDF, you can print using a Postscript driver to a virtual LPT port which is redirected to Postscript to PDF converter tool. If possible, use the fixed EPS library from Grossibaer.
